Archicad 27 on a MAC platform. For some reason, all my beams are solid pink. I tried looking at all the graphic 0verrides, and all the different settings don't help.

Hi Mukster,

 

I can think of two other possible issues:

  1. Some building material / composite / surface / texture is missing
  2. If the beam is actually a wall or column element it's height could be inverted. (See: https://community.graphisoft.com/t5/Modeling/Pink-Walls/td-p/163922)

When you hover over an element, if a Graphic Override is affecting it, it should show up as highlighted below.
That might help isolate the rule.
As mentioned above, if there's no rule affecting the element, it could be missing attribute, although this normally shows as black and pink checkers.
